Angela Corona Mph

Angela Corona, MPH, serves as the Health Systems Manager and Health and Hunger Strategy Specialist at Second Harvest Food Bank of Central Florida since February 2021. Prior experience includes roles as Regional Public Health Specialist at UF/IFAS Extension and Coordinated Entry Rapid Rehousing Operations Supervisor for the Orange County Government/Homeless Services Network of Central Florida. Angela has led initiatives in developing coordinated housing solutions for families experiencing homelessness and implemented program policies to improve service delivery. Previous positions also include Grants and Special Projects Coordinator at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center, Project Coordinator roles at Oklahoma State University and Rural Women's Health Project, and Health Educator at Iglesia Gran Comision. Angela holds a Master's degree in Public Health from the University of Florida and a Bachelor of Science in Health Education and Behavior from the same institution.

Second Harvest Food Bank of Central Florida

Second Harvest Food Bank of Central Florida (SHFBCF) is a member of Feeding America – the largest charitable domestic hunger-relief organization in the United States. SHFBCF secures and distributes food and grocery products to more than 625 local nonprofit feeding partners throughout Central Florida. Through the help of food and financial donors, volunteers and a caring, committed community, the food bank distributes 300,000 meals every day to a seven-county service area.
